Tattoo Training Course
Course Overview:
The Professional Tattoo Training Program is designed for aspiring tattoo artists who are passionate about the craft and eager to develop their skills in a professional setting. This comprehensive course offers a blend of theoretical knowledge, technical skills, and practical experience, ensuring that students are well-equipped to begin their careers in the tattoo industry.
Course Objectives:
To provide students with a solid understanding of tattoo history, culture, and ethics.
To teach the fundamentals of skin anatomy and tattoo machine operation.
To develop artistic skills in drawing, design, and color theory specific to tattoo art.
To ensure proficiency in hygiene, safety practices, and sanitary regulations required in tattooing.
To offer hands-on experience through supervised tattooing sessions on practice skin and models.
To prepare students for professional life as a tattoo artist, including client interaction and portfolio development.
